Santa University

Santa School

Ivy League Santa

We all know that Santa can't possibly be in every mall and store for appearances in the weeks leading up to Christmas - he's busy at the North Pole preparing for Christmas Eve! So where do all these Official Santa Helpers come from? You might be surprised to learn that there's a good chance they...
Read More